...
This Section should explain how the idea of a plugin is born, what is the purpose of this plugin and the who all can use this pluginplugin
Design
The implementation Design of the pluginplugin
UI Design (portal/mobile)
The Proposed UI design has to be published
Implementation (Code)
...
Integration Testing
The plugin will list all the touchpoints where the plugin can affect the application and any service it is using from the framework and will write the automated test for each of the use case.
The plugin will use the framework exposed system to do the automated integration testing.
Publishing
A standard process to build and publish the plugin will be exposed by the framework do that all plugin will follow the same process.
...